Purpose
The project aims to develop technology to support aging in place through an integrated decision support for health and safety. A new nutritional tracking system will be developed, which leverages machine learning and computer vision algorithms to specifically reduce frailty risk and age-related muscle loss (sarcopenia) in elderly people. In particular, sources of protein, vitamin D and calcium as well as estimated intake of these nutrients will be analyzed. To this end, an e-screening tool for self-management and risk assessment will be developed along with machine learning methods to estimate both food volume and intake. To evaluate this intelligent tracking system, a food intake dataset including food weights, volume, amount intake, and image sensor measurements will be created over the course of the project. The project is a foundational step toward a longer-term project to work with older adults to facilitate aging in place by assessing and monitoring their food intake with their doctor/dietitian.
